Repository tools command to import users from a file
Use the importUsers command to create or update a batch of users from a file.
Purpose
The importUsers command can be used to create or update a batch of users from a CSV file. The CSV file is comma separated value that lists:userid,name,email@example.org,[com.ibm.team.foundation.user],[JazzUser],0
userid
is the user ID of the user.name
is the name of the user.email@example.org
is the email address of the user.[com.ibm.team.foundation.user]
is the list of licenses.[JazzUser]
is the list of repository groups.0
means that the user is not archived. If the user is archived, this value is 1.
Important: The server must be running when
you run the command.
Parameters
Attribute | Description | Required | Default |
---|---|---|---|
fromFile | The path to the file containing the users to be created or updated. The format of the file is a comma separated list of userid, name, email address, license id(s), and repository group name(s). | Yes | users.csv |
generatePassword | Use this parameter to generate random passwords for newly created users, instead of using a password that matches the user ID. | No | N/A |
repositoryURL | The connection URL for the server. | No | https://localhost:9443/application where application is jts, ccm, rm, qm, gc, dcc, or relm. |
adminUserId | Administrator user ID to login to the Jazz repository. | No | ADMIN |
adminPassword | Administrator password to login to the Jazz repository. | No | ADMIN |
credentialsFile | The file containing the administrator user's login credentials. | No | credentials.properties |
certificateFile | The file containing the administrator user's login certificate. | No | none |
smartCard | The alias to login using a smart card, or ? to list available aliases. | No | none |
logFile | Path to the log file. | No | repotools-application_importUsers.log where application is jts, ccm, rm, qm, gc, dcc, or relm. |
kerberos | Authenticate with Windows user credentials using Kerberos/SPNEGO by setting to true. Or authenticate with Windows Integrated Authentication by setting to windows. | No | None |
Sample
The following example is for Jazz®
Team Server. To use
this command for other applications, run these options from the server directory:
- IBM® Engineering Workflow Management (Change and Configuration Management application): repotools-ccm
- IBM Engineering Requirements Management DOORS® Next (Requirements Management application): repotools-rm
- IBM Engineering Test Management (Quality Management application): repotools-qm
- Global Configuration Management: repotools-gc
- Data Collection Component: repotools-dcc
- IBM Engineering Lifecycle Optimization - Engineering Insights: repotools-relm
Open a command prompt and enter this command:
cd C:\Program Files\IBM\JazzTeamServer\server\
repotools-jts.bat -importUsers fromFile=C:\users.csv repositoryURL=https://hostname.example.com:9443/jts kerberos=true
Open a command line and enter this command:
cd opt/IBM/JazzTeamServer/server/ ./repotools-jts.sh -importUsers fromFile=opt/users.csv repositoryURL=https://hostname.example.com:9443/jts
